Cyclades Gulet Cruise Details
Boarding your gulet
Departure Port: Syros Island
Embarkation: Saturday evening at 7:00 PM
Departure: Sunday morning
Disembarkation: The following Saturday morning
You can easily reach Syros by ferry from Rafina, Mykonos, or Piraeus (Athens), or by domestic flight from Athens. On your return, you’ll have time to explore Syros before departing by ferry to Athens, Mykonos, or Santorini.

Day 1
Boarding your gulet at the port of Syros – New port after 6 pm.
Day 2
We will begin our sailing . We will spend the day in spectacular bay. Serifos is a peaceful and authentic island, known for its wild beauty, golden sandy beaches, and charming whitewashed villages. Its hilltop capital, Chora, offers breathtaking views of the Aegean and a true taste of traditional island life.
Day 3
In the morning is ideal time for navigation to Milos. Milos, the “island of colors,” is celebrated for its spectacular rock formations, unique beaches, and volcanic landscapes.
Day 4
Milos boasts some of the most spectacular beaches in the Aegean, many of which are accessible only by boat. Among them, Kleftiko stands out with its dramatic white cliffs and sea caves — perfect for swimming and snorkeling. Sykia Cave, with its natural skylight, offers a magical experience, while Gerakas and Kalogries enchant visitors with their turquoise waters and untouched beauty. Exploring these hidden gems by gulet allows you to discover the true, wild side of Milos, far from the crowds and in complete harmony with nature.
Day 5
In the morning we reach Kimolos island. Kimolos is a hidden gem of the Cyclades, ideal for those seeking tranquility and simplicity. With its crystal-clear waters, quiet coves, and stone-built houses, it feels like a journey back in time.
Day 6
After breakfast we will reach the island Sifnos. This blends elegance and authenticity, famous for its gastronomy, pottery, and hiking trails. Its picturesque villages and turquoise beaches make it one of the most refined yet relaxed islands in the Aegean.
Day 7
Sun and sea in the isolated paradise of uninhabited island on the way back to Syros. Will be on our last day of wonderful swims before returning to Syros for last evening on board.
Day 8
Disembarkation after breakfast at the port of Syros.
